Toyota RAV4: A Comprehensive Overview of Toyota’s Versatile SUV

The Toyota RAV4 has long been a staple in the compact SUV market, renowned for its reliability, versatility, and overall value. Since its debut in 1994, the RAV4 has evolved significantly, maintaining its status as a popular choice for families, commuters, and adventure enthusiasts alike. This article provides an in-depth look at the Toyota RAV4, highlighting its design, performance, features, and the reasons behind its continued success.

Design and Interior

The Toyota RAV4 has undergone a series of design transformations, with the latest models showcasing a bold, modern aesthetic. Its angular lines, prominent grille, and sleek LED headlights give it a contemporary and dynamic appearance. The SUV’s rugged exterior design, with available trims like the Adventure and TRD Off-Road, caters to those seeking a more off-road-ready look and capability.

Inside, the RAV4 offers a spacious and well-designed cabin that balances functionality with comfort. The interior features a clean, intuitive layout with high-quality materials. The RAV4’s seating configuration allows for five passengers, and the rear seats fold flat to expand cargo space, making it versatile for various needs. With a maximum cargo capacity of over 69 cubic feet, the RAV4 accommodates everything from family gear to outdoor equipment.
